Decatur, GA Apartments for Rent

Decatur, Georgia, located just five miles northeast of downtown Atlanta, combines historic charm with metropolitan accessibility. Those searching for apartments for rent in Decatur will discover a welcoming downtown square, local restaurants, and an active arts community. Established in 1823 and named after naval hero Commodore Stephen Decatur, the city serves as the county seat of DeKalb County and has evolved into a walkable community with convenient access to Atlanta via three MARTA rail stations.

Decatur's rental market includes both contemporary apartment communities and restored historic properties, with one-bedroom apartments averaging $1,367 per month. The city is home to Agnes Scott College and Columbia Theological Seminary, while downtown hosts annual traditions like the AJC Decatur Book Festival. With historic neighborhoods like MAK and Winnona Park, local boutiques, and dining options throughout the downtown area, Decatur offers a connected community experience with easy access to Atlanta's employment districts.

Frequently asked questions about renting in Decatur, GA

What are the average rent costs in Decatur, GA?

The average rent in Decatur, GA is $1,383.

What are the average rent costs of a studio apartment in Decatur, GA?

The average rent for a studio apartment in Decatur, GA is $1,461.

What are the average rent costs of a one bedroom apartment in Decatur, GA?

The average rent for a 1 bedroom apartment in Decatur, GA is $1,383.

What are the average rent costs of a two bedroom apartment in Decatur, GA?

The average rent for a 2 bedroom apartment in Decatur, GA is $1,567.

What are the average rent costs of a three bedroom apartment in Decatur, GA?

The average rent for a 3 bedroom apartment in Decatur, GA is $1,815.

What are the average rent costs of a four bedroom apartment in Decatur, GA?

The average rent for a 4 bedroom apartment in Decatur, GA is $1,928.
